Keywords

Search engine optimization (SEO) is a complicated subject with a myriad of factors that influence how content is ranked on Google or other search engines. Keywords play a significant part in these variables. However the term "keywords" isn't referring to one particular group of words, but rather an assortment of related words that users might search for. If a user is searching for information on hiking boots, they could use words like "hiking", "boots" and "best". The first step to optimizing your content is to identify which keywords are relevant to your audience. This will allow you to make sure your content is targeted to the right audience, and will increase the chance of it being found by those who are interested in it.

On-page optimization

On-page optimization is a key element of any SEO campaign It includes strategies that can be implemented directly on your site. It is a process that should be dependent on an analysis of your current performance and your goals. It should include regular updates and monitoring to ensure that your content is relevant to the keywords you're aiming at. In extreme cases optimization methods that aren't based on an in-depth analysis could cause the opposite effect. For example they could cause a drop in your conversion rates, or even affect the stability of your search engine rankings.

On-page SEO concentrates on the elements of your site that you can control, such as the quality of your content and the structure of your site, and the page speed. This is crucial, since it's crucial to have a good website before you focus on off-page aspects such as link building. In fact, if your on-page optimization isn't at standards, it'll be difficult to rank for your desired keywords and generate organic traffic.

There are a variety of ways to improve your on-page optimization. But some of the most essential are:

The title tag is an HTML tag that tells search engines what your webpage is about. It is displayed on results pages of search engines (or SERPs). It is crucial to include your primary keyword in the title tag to ensure that you rank for that keyword.

Another important aspect of optimizing your on-page is the meta description. It is the description that appears under your URL in a search engine result page. It's important to provide a compelling explanation that will entice users to click on your results.

Page speed is an important on-page factor, as it determines how long it will take for a page to load. A slow page will discourage your visitors from staying on your website and will adversely affect your website's rank.

There are a variety of ways to boost the speed of a website such as removing duplicate content or optimizing images. Off-page optimization

Off-page optimization is the process of promoting your website and gaining exposure through other channels. Guest blogging, social media, guest blogging and link building are all examples. This type of marketing plays an essential role in a successful digital campaign. It also helps to build brand awareness and authority. It will help you rank higher in search results and lead to more leads.

Many people use the terms off-page and on-page SEO interchangeably, they are two distinct things. On-page SEO is the portion of your website you can manage, like the density of keywords and the title of your page. Off-page optimization, on other hand, focuses on increasing authority by promoting your site. This includes activities such as link building, social networking marketing, and leveraging directories on the internet.

Off-page SEO is important because it lets search engines know what other users think of your website. Backlinks are the most crucial element in off-page SEO since they are like votes of trust. A website that has many of these is considered trustworthy and relevant.

A blog is an excellent method to improve your off-page SEO. This will let you publish your own content and also encourage readers to visit the website. Another method for off-page SEO is to submit your articles to directories. You can use online submission sites to do this.

Infographics can be used to promote your content. They are a great way to increase traffic and capture people's attention. They can be shared on social media platforms and could even lead to branded search results. They aren't ranking factors directly, but they can affect your rankings.

Broken link building is an additional efficient off-page SEO technique. This involves identifying broken links on other websites and offering to replace these links with relevant links back to your website. This can help them reduce the number of 404 errors and improve their user experience. In addition, it can aid in gaining valuable backlinks. Link building

Link building is the process of generating backlinks to your website. It is one of the most important factors in search engine optimization and it can have a significant impact on your SEO rankings. However, it is important to recognize that the quality of your links is more important than the quantity. Therefore, it's an ideal idea to concentrate on links that are of high-quality and from reputable websites. Avoid using unnatural or spammy methods.

In the past, SEOs have used questionable methods to manipulate their rankings. This led to Google publishing a series of updates that penalized these practices. These updates, which are often referred to as the Penguin Updates have altered the game for webmasters. To be successful, marketers need to be aware of these new rules and develop an approach that doesn't violate them.
